Device and method for detection of analytes
The present invention provides assays and devices for detection of substances in liquid samples. The assays and devices utilize passive diffusion between a porous material and a porous membrane containing a specific binding pair member to enable detection of the substance of interest.
1. A device for detecting the presence or amount of a substance of interest in a liquid sample, the device comprising:
a sample receiving zone for receiving the liquid sample,
wherein the sample receiving zone is present on a porous material;
a sample filtering zone for filtering the liquid sample received at the sample receiving zone,
wherein the sample filtering zone is present on the porous material, and wherein the sample receiving zone and the sample filtering zone are integral with the porous material;
a porous membrane comprising a specific binding pair member at a detection zone that specifically binds to the substance of interest or a substance bound to the substance of interest,
wherein the porous membrane is a separate element from the porous material, and
wherein the porous material and porous membrane are in physical contact over at least an area comprising a portion of the detection zone, and wherein the porous material and porous membrane are in physical contact in a configuration that permits liquid present in the liquid sample to diffuse in, out, through, and about the porous membrane in a substantially random, non-directional manner in an area comprising at least a portion of the detection zone.
